What Are DTF Inks?

DTF (Direct to Fabric) inks are a specialized type of ink designed for use on fabric. They are unique because they can be printed directly onto the material without the need for any other mediums, such as heat transfers or screen printing. This makes them ideal for a variety of applications, from apparel to upholstery and home décor. DTF inks come in a wide range of colors, textures, and finishes, allowing you to customize your project

What Makes DTF Inks Different?

Good-quality DTF inks provide a few advantages over traditional screen printing methods. First, they require no screens or setup costs since they’re applied directly onto the fabric without any additional equipment. Second, they offer superior durability and washability compared to other printing methods since the ink bonds directly with the fiber structure of the fabric. Third, DTF inks allow for greater precision when it comes to detail and color accuracy due to their ability to be printed right onto the material itself. Finally, these inks come with an array of special effects that make them perfect for creating unique designs on fabric.

Where Can You Use DTF Inks?

DTF inks can be used on almost any type of fabric, including cotton, polyester, spandex blends, nylon blends, and more. These versatile inks are perfect for creating custom apparel such as t-shirts, hoodies, and hats, custom upholstery, home décor items like throw pillows, flags, banners, and much more. With so many possibilities at your fingertips, you can create truly unique pieces that showcase your creativity.

How Do You Use DTF Inks?

Using DFT inks is easy, but there are some important steps you must follow to ensure successful results:

1) Pre-treat Your Fabric

Before applying your design, it’s important to pre-treat your fabric with a heat press or steam iron so that it’s clean and free from wrinkles or creases, which could affect print quality.

2) Prepare Your Design

Once you have prepared your surface, it’s time to prepare your design using software such as Adobe Illustrator or CorelDraw. This will allow you to create an image file compatible with most printers capable of working with DFT inkjet cartridges.

3) Print Your Design

After preparing your artwork, it’s time to print. Most printers capable of working with DTF cartridges have built-in settings specifically designed for this medium, so make sure these are selected before the printing process; otherwise, results may not turn out as desired.

4) Heat Set The Ink

Once finished printing, make sure to leave ink for enough time to dry before applying a heat setting process which will help bond ink fibers together, making them even more durable and washable than before. To do this, simply use either an iron set at a low temperature setting with no steam function.

5) Wash & Care For Your Projects

Last, but not least, make sure to follow the washing instructions provided by the manufacturer in order to maintain the longevity of the new printed fabric. Additionally, watch out for washing instructions and detergents that are compatible with washing these printed fabrics.
